Have developed a problem with my SM-20 Desk Mic. At first it starts to
work fine, good alc indication and shows rf power output and the scope
shows output. As I talk I noticed the ALC starts to bleed off and stops
at zero, my scope on the radio still show an output indication. If I
unkey and rekey it shows good ALC but then bleeds off again then I start
getting reports of breaking up, sounds of RF and when I'm speaking into
mic the reports say it sound like I am crunching some paper in front of
the mic.
I took the plug apart that goes to the radio all connections and solder
look ok, jiggled all the cords on the mic and thought I had it isolated
to a bad wire but when I took it all apart everything looks ok and
continuity checks on the cables all looked good. I can also hear the
break up problem on the radio monitor system but not the crunchy paper
sound.
This just started a week ago and my hand mic that comes with the PRO is
working ok.....Any ideas gang and does the mic element cover unscrew so I
can check there? Thanks and hope some one can help, 73 Mac
